Pros & Cons

Auto-generated from official data — head-to-head differences and gaps vs the national average.

Carrollton, TX
Pros
Households earn $40,329 more per year on average
85% less violent crime than Greensboro
Violent crime is well below the national average (137.1 vs 380/100k)
Stronger job market — unemployment is 1.8 pts lower (3.7%)
Milder winters — January highs near 56°F vs 50°F
Smaller class sizes — 13.5:1 student-teacher ratio
Cons
Pricier housing — median home is $327,300
Higher rents — median is $1,555/mo
Cost of living runs 11% higher than Greensboro
Greensboro, NC
Pros
Homes cost $130k less ($197,200 vs $327,300)
Rent averages $507/mo less ($1,048 vs $1,555)
11% cheaper overall cost of living than Carrollton
Commutes run 3 min shorter each way
Living costs sit below the national average (index 92.7)
Cooler summers — July highs near 89°F vs 94°F
Cons
Median income trails Carrollton by $40,329/yr
Violent crime (923.7/100k) is above the U.S. average of 380
Property crime (3383.1/100k) runs high vs the U.S. average
Higher unemployment (5.5% vs 3.7%)

Frequently Asked Questions

Carrollton's cost of living index is 103.3 vs Greensboro's 92.7 (US average = 100). Greensboro is 11% less expensive overall.
Based on the 23 decided categories above, Carrollton leads 15 of 23 categories. Carrollton wins 15 and Greensboro wins 8. The right choice depends on your priorities — use the Pros & Cons and full table above to weigh what matters to you.
Whether you're moving from Carrollton to Greensboro or relocating the other way, focus on the biggest gaps: housing ($327,300 vs $197,200 median home), income ($95,380 vs $55,051), safety, and schools — all covered in the full table above.
Carrollton, TX and Greensboro, NC are about 994 miles apart (straight-line distance). Driving distance will be longer depending on the route.
